More About North Saanich

Rolling hills, laid-back valleys, generously protected parklands, agricultural farmlands, and quiet residential areas surrounded by long stretches of beach and cozy bays on three sides with a balmy sea, and sunsets so dramatic they take your breath away. It's no wonder North Saanich consistently ranks high on the list of the finest rural-residential areas in all of Canada. 

Travel around these places through the convenience of its air and sea transportation or just opt to have the adventurous way of hiking, cycling, or horseback riding through an extensive park and trails network linking municipal, regional, and provincial parklands. Another way is, of course, hitting the road while feasting your eyes with its picturesque farms, roadside produce, and flower stand.

With 11 neighborhoods, there are a lot of places to choose from, most notably happy places like Deep Cove, Sidney, and the ferry terminal at Swartz Bay. 

A large part of the Saanich peninsula measuring about 37 square kilometers, there's undoubtedly no shortage of unbelievably beautiful natural attractions, fun things to do in the water and on land, and community delights that entice visitors and home-lookers from all over the world to visit, travel, and settle around North Saanich.
